Как работать с асинхронным запросом в C#?

Работа с асинхронными запросами в C# является важным аспектом разработки современных приложений, особенно тех, которые требуют взаимодействия с веб-сервисами, базами данных или другими сетевыми ресурсами. В этом ответе мы рассмотрим,…

Читать дальше
Как создать и работать с объектами в Python?

В языке программирования Python объекты являются основой для создания структурированных данных и представления информации. Объекты позволяют инкапсулировать данные и функции, которые с ними работают, что является одним из основных принципов…

Читать дальше
Как создать сессионное хранилище данных?

Создание сессионного хранилища данных является важной частью разработки веб-приложений, позволяющей сохранять данные на стороне клиента. В данной статье мы подробно рассмотрим, как использовать sessionStorage в JavaScript для реализации сессионного хранилища.…

Читать дальше
Как обновить зависимости в проекте Node.js?

Обновление зависимостей в проекте Node.js — это важный процесс, который помогает поддерживать ваш проект в актуальном состоянии и использовать последние версии библиотек. Существует несколько способов обновления зависимостей, и в этой…

Читать дальше
Что такое двусвязный список?

Двусвязный список – это одна из структур данных, которая состоит из последовательности элементов, называемых узлами. Каждый узел в двусвязном списке содержит три основных компонента: данные, ссылка на следующий узел и…

Читать дальше
Как использовать виртуальное окружение в Python?

Виртуальное окружение в Python — это мощный инструмент, который позволяет создавать изолированные среды для ваших проектов. Это особенно полезно, когда у вас есть несколько проектов, требующих различных версий библиотек или…

Читать дальше
Что такое обработка ошибок с try-catch?

Обработка ошибок – это важная часть программирования, позволяющая разработчику управлять ситуациями, когда в программе возникают исключительные состояния, т.е. ситуации, которые не могут быть обработаны стандартным образом. В языках программирования, таких…

Читать дальше
Что такое рефакторинг кода?

Рефакторинг кода – это процесс изменения внутренней структуры программного кода без изменения его внешнего поведения. Основная цель рефакторинга заключается в улучшении читаемости и управляемости кода, а также в устранении долговременных…

Читать дальше
Что такое Node.js и как его использовать?

Node.js — это платформа для разработки серверных приложений, построенная на JavaScript. Она позволяет запускать JavaScript-код на стороне сервера, что делает его универсальным языком для разработки как клиентской, так и серверной…

Читать дальше
Как использовать template engine в Django?

В Django использование шаблонов (template engine) позволяет разделять логику приложения и представление данных. Это делает код более структурированным и удобным для поддержки. В этом ответе мы подробно рассмотрим, как использовать…

Читать дальше
Как создать REST API на Flask?

Создание REST API на Flask — это отличный способ научиться разрабатывать веб-приложения и сервисы. Flask — это легковесный фреймворк для веб-разработки на Python, который позволяет быстро создавать приложения. В этом…

Читать дальше
Что такое полиморфизм в программировании?

Полиморфизм в программировании — это один из ключевых принципов объектно-ориентированного программирования (ООП), который позволяет объектам разных классов обрабатывать данные одинаковым образом, даже если их внутренние реализации различаются. Это означает, что…

Читать дальше
Как создать интерфейс на Java?

Создание интерфейса на Java — это важный аспект разработки приложений, особенно когда речь идет о графических интерфейсах пользователя (GUI). В этом ответе мы рассмотрим основные аспекты, которые помогут вам создать…

Читать дальше
Как обрабатывать исключения в Java?

В языке программирования Java обработка исключений является важной частью разработки, позволяющей управлять ошибками и исключительными ситуациями, которые могут возникнуть во время выполнения программы. Это достигается с помощью использования конструкции try-catch.…

Читать дальше
Что такое строковые методы в Python?

Строковые методы в Python представляют собой набор функций, которые позволяют эффективно работать со строками. Эти методы обеспечивают множество возможностей для обработки текстовых данных, включая изменение их формата, поиск подстрок, замену…

Читать дальше
Что такое архитектура MVC?

Архитектура MVC (Model-View-Controller) — это шаблон проектирования, который широко используется для организации кода в приложениях, особенно в веб-разработке. Этот подход разделяет приложение на три основных компонента: Модель (Model) — отвечает…

Читать дальше
Как проверить тип данных в Python?

В языке программирования Python проверка типа данных – это важная задача, которая может помочь разработчикам лучше понимать, с какими данными они работают. В Python есть несколько способов, позволяющих проверить тип…

Читать дальше
Как создать простой сайт с использованием HTML?

Создание простого сайта с использованием HTML — это отличный способ начать изучение веб-разработки. В этом руководстве мы рассмотрим, как создать базовую веб-страницу, используя основные элементы HTML. HTML (HyperText Markup Language)…

Читать дальше